Who: Ritual Howls

What: Rendered Armor

When: March 2019

Where: felte

Why: Detroit's version of spaghetti western twang colliding with sleek, industrial synths. With Paul Bancell's Nick Cave-esque vocals adding high drama to an already theatrical sonic palette, Rendered Armor's razor blade riffs, hulking basslines, and sinister synths make this a perfect listen for a world in a waking nightmare of unbridled chaos. One can't escape a certain sense of impending doom, a dark foreboding that draws breath in every note. Magnificently morbid, these black blues are sublime.
